| Harrisburg, PA | Knoxville, TN | United States |
Overall | 89.8 | 91.8 | 100 |
Food & Groceries | 97.2 | 97.2 | 100 |
Health | 109.4 | 97.5 | 100 |
Housing | 64.5 | 88.2 | 100 |
Median Home Cost | $212,400 | $314,700 | $338,100 |
Utilities | 10,240.0% | 9,560.0% | 10,000.0% |
Transportation | 88.3 | 81.8 | 100 |
Miscellaneous | 128.1 | 100.8 | 100 |
100 = National Average (Below 100 means cheaper than the US average. Above 100 means more expensive.)
